ABOUT: Jordan Allen Broder, Director & Lead Violinist
Jordan Allen Broder, an accomplished violinist and saxophonist, has established a reputation for his support and promotion of the arts. Completing a formal education in music performance, production and artist management, Mr. Broder has collaborated with a diverse roster of classical, jazz and contemporary talent, including the International Chamber Soloists, Birmingham Bloomfield Symphony Orchestra and Michigan Philharmonic (Guest Concertmaster), rock sensation Trans-Siberian Orchestra, Lindsey Stirling, Evanescence, Jazz at Lincoln Center and prize-winners of "Miss Michigan," "Miss America," and "Miss USA." As Director & Lead Violinist of the electro-pop violin & DJ band NUCLASSICA® (Nominated, "Best Entertainment 2014-2019" Michigan Meetings + Events Magazine), Mr. Broder led the group to their Carnegie Hall debut in 2025, appeared on Season 11 of NBC's America's Got Talent, and opened for artists including The Temptations, The Jacksons, John Legend, The Chainsmokers, Pitbull, Michael Bublé, Ludacris, Dan + Shay, Sean Kingston, Corrine Bailey Rae, Flo-Rida and Nelly. In addition to maintaining a busy performance schedule with NUCLASSICA®, Mr. Broder is VP of The Broder Portfolio Property Advisors, and oversees all operations of Broder Talent Group (BTG), specializing in the personal management and representation of musical talent within the entertainment and modeling industries. Mr. Broder is currently President & Artistic Director of the non-profit National Music Institute (NMI). |
